Contract Approval Process
Registers a draft contract and gets approval from a supervisor and the legal dept. The draft contract is revised repeatedly until being approved at the [2. Approval by supervisor] and [3. Approval by Legal] Steps. After approval the contract is negotiated and the result is recorded at the [4. Register Conclusion] Step.
BPMN Nodes
  • 1 1. Register Contract draft The person in charge registers the draft contract.
  • 3 1x. Rework The drafter responds to the boss’s indications and amends the draft.
  • 5 1y. Rework The drafter responds to the legal indications and amends or withdraws the draft.
  • 2 2. Approval by superior The drafter’s boss approves the draft or returns if any deficiencies.
  • 4 3. Approval By Legal Legal personnel reviews and approves the draft. If there are any deficiencies, point them out and asks for correction.
  • 6 4. Register Conclusion The person in charge reports the result of the contract negotiation.
  • 11 5. Confirmation on Conclusion The boss of the person in charge confirms the result report.
